What is a superfood
The term superfood was born more as a strategy of marketing to designate those foods concentrated in good nutrients and with a positive impact on health.
Some dictionaries define a superfood as a nutrient-dense foodespecially in fiber, antioxidants, vitamins, minerals or unsaturated fatty acids that are beneficial for health.
However, the term superfood is controversial and even subjectivesince we find at our disposal a variety of products and foods with healthy nutrients and it is not easy to know which is a remarkable product due to its qualities or its impact on our body.

Almonds, a very nutritious dry fruit
The almonds They are, like other nuts, foods concentrated in quality nutrients, but according to a study that evaluated more than 1,000 ingredients for their impact on the body and its components, almonds stand out among many.
It is a concentrated source of vegetable proteins and unsaturated fats beneficial for the organism but also, they are a good option to add potassium, vegetable calcium and vitamins of group B to our usual diet.
Clearly, it’s a very accessible dry fruit and that we can easily incorporate into our table to enrich it with healthy nutrients.
Extra virgin olive oil: liquid gold
Extra virgin olive oil, typical of the Mediterranean diet, is another food that is within reach of our hands and is source of quality fats and phenolic compounds with antioxidant and anti-inflammatory action in our body.
For these qualities, and above all for its great impact on the health of the body that can help us control body weight by increasing metabolic expenditure, as well as prevent cardiovascular or degenerative diseases such as cancer; he extra virgin olive oil It is another superfood that we can easily incorporate into our daily diet.
Avocado: a remarkable fruit
Unlike other fresh fruits, the avocado constitutes a excellent source of fatty acids with a reduced proportion of carbohydrates, being at the same time concentrated in fiber, vitamins, minerals and with a higher proportion of proteins than many other plant foods.
Also, the avocado It is a very versatile food that has been associated with good control of body weight, as well as its richness in monounsaturated fatty acids, it can help prevent cardiovascular diseases and easily enrich our diet, especially since it can be used to replace other less fatty acids. healthy.
Kale or collard greens: few calories and lots of nutrients
Kale is one of the most recognized superfoods, yet the cabbage of a lifetime and that we get very easily in the market can be a good alternative, also concentrated in quality nutrients and very low in calories.
Cabbage stands out for its great contribution of vegetable proteins as well as for its wealth in calciumin vitamin C and other antioxidant compounds.
At the same time, like other cabbages, it offers a high content of potassium, B vitamins and flavonoids that they can have a anti-inflammatory effect in our body.
Peanuts, soybeans, kidney beans and other legumes
The legumes In general, they are excellent sources of nutrients for our body and we recommend including them in the regular diet whenever possible.
Among the most outstanding specimens that we can call superfoods within reach of our hands are the peanut and the soy sources of protein in high proportions and unsaturated fats that are beneficial to the body, as well as beans concentrated in quality vegetable protein, fiber and micronutrients.
Also, all legumes are vegetable source of iron, potassium, B vitamins and polyphenols that have anti-inflammatory action in our body.
Turmeric, to give flavor and color to many dishes
The turmeric It is a spice that we can easily obtain today in markets and supermarkets and that we can use to flavor different dishes.
It constitutes an excellent source of antioxidants as well as vitamins and minerals, but above all its richness in curcumin, a component with anti-inflammatory effect in our body that can greatly benefit the health of the organism.
Green tea: a super infusion
Among other superfoods that we can easily incorporate into our regular diet is Green Tea, an infusion that is widely consumed among the Japanese and that concentrates polyphenols with very beneficial properties for our body.
green tea is source of catechins that raise our metabolism and considerably help maintain body weight while also offering phenolic compounds that can keep us away from metabolic and degenerative diseases such as cancer.
We always recommend consume green tea without added sugar and incorporate it as a regular infusion, since in addition to benefiting from its compounds will contribute to proper hydration of the organism.
